Residing in the charming town of Padstow, Cornwall, this stylish vacation property, known as Avocets, offers breathtaking views of the Camel Estuary. The home is designed to accommodate up to six guests, featuring three well-appointed bedrooms: one kingsize, one twin, and two bunk beds. Guests can enjoy the scenic vistas from various areas of the house, including the deck, main bedroom, lounge/diner, and kitchen, making it an ideal retreat for families or groups looking for a tranquil getaway.
Avocets is conveniently situated just a five-minute walk from Padstow's picturesque harbour, where visitors can explore a diverse array of shops, cafes, and restaurants. The property is fully accessible on one level, ensuring ease of movement throughout. Essential amenities include a well-equipped kitchen with modern appliances such as a double electric oven, gas hob, microwave/combi oven, and a Nespresso coffee machine, alongside a Smart TV and Sky Q for entertainment.
Outdoor spaces enhance the property's appeal, featuring a lawn area with garden furniture and a barbecue, perfect for al fresco dining. A garage is available for storing bikes and surfboards, catering to those who wish to explore the nearby beaches and outdoor activities. While pets are not permitted, the property provides parking for two cars on the driveway, ensuring convenience for guests traveling by vehicle.
Guests can enjoy complimentary WiFi and gas-fired central heating throughout the home. It is important to note that smoking is not allowed on the premises, and an Accidental Damage Deposit may be required. The property is located within close proximity to local attractions, including the Padstow Museum, Cornwall Aviation Heritage Centre, and various family-friendly activities such as Camel Creek Adventure Park and the National Lobster Hatchery, making it a perfect base for exploring the beauty and culture of the South West of England.
